Batista’s New Movie “Guardians of the Galaxy” Opens to Great Reviews, My Thoughts on the Movie & Batista’s Performance

guardians of the galaxyDave “Batista” Bautista’s new movie, “Guardians of the Galaxy,” officially opened today, and has received great reviews, generating a 92% score on RottenTomatoes.com.

Of the 156 reviews submitted, the film has garnered 143 positive reviews and only 13 negative reviews.

Paglino: I saw the movie last night, and agree with the positive reviews. If you are a fan of the “Guardians of the Galaxy” comic books, you will no doubt be a fan of the movie. The characters are dynamic, quirky, true to the source material, and are all, as Rocket self-proclaims, “jackasses.”

If you are not familiar with the source material I’d guess you’ll still like the movie, but if you’re only familiar with other Marvel works, this one is very different. At it’s nature it’s sarcastic and comedic, and where stories like The Avengers and X-Men are rooted in a bit more seriousness, this story certainly is not.

As for Batista, he is excellent as Drax The Destroyer. It helps that all the characters are very well written and three-dimensional, but Batista gives a performance you will anticipate when the sequel comes out. I dare say he’s perfect for the role, and off the top of my head can’t think of anyone of his likeness that could nail the nuances of the character quite like Batista.
